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| bull-oak | Sweetscented marigold |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Fagales (Beeches & Oaks) |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) |
| Family | Casuarinaceae |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) |
| Genus | Allocasuarina | Tagetes |
| Species | Allocasuarina fraseriana | Tagetes lucida |
Evolutionary Relationship
bull-oak and Sweetscented marigold share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
